VALLETTA F.C. LAUNCHES MOBILE PHONE SERVICE

Valletta Football Club is proud to launch it’s own mobile phone service under the name “VFC Mobile“.

This is yet another first in Maltese football and further adds to the club’s merchandise and projects.

The service will be launched in partnership with Aspider Solutions YOM Ltd. and will be using the radio network of Vodafone whereby customers will be able to enjoy the reliability of the Vodafone radio network as well as the many international roaming partners, that Vodafone has a roaming agreement with, while travelling.

During a press conference held at the Le Merdien, St Julians, club President Victor Sciriha said that this was another important page in the history of the club which was always at the forefront in new ventures to tap the potential of its considerable pool of loyal supporters.

Mr. Sciriha inaugurated the service by making the first call on VFC mobile and announced that there will be special offers for customers who will be joining the VFC mobile community, details of which will be communicated at a later stage.

Customers joining VFC Mobile may retain their existing mobile number or buy a new number. The VFC mobile tariffs are very competitive and amongst the lowest in the market.

The Valletta FC President said that the club would also be launching a competition for its mobile subscribers which will culminate at the end of June where the lucky winner would be taken with the with the team to a club’s away international commitment in Europe.

Victor Sciriha ended by thanking Matthew Mullholland for designing the VFC Mobile logo, Jean Pierre Baldacchino, David Xuereb and Ricky Reeves for their help.

Malcolm Mallia, Director of YOM VFC mobile’s partner in this venture, said that YOM was very excited to be introducing mobile telephony into the sports arena and will be doing this with the biggest football club in Malta which has a such a rich history of successes, and looked forward to yet another clubb success story.

The club’s aim is definitely not to compete with the big operators but to offer trusted rich services to loyal communities like the one Valletta FC has with its fans.

Valletta are making good on their promise to become the first Maltese club to operate their own mobile phone service.

More than a year has elapsed since the Citizens unfurled their mobile phone project but the Premier League leaders now have everything in place to launch the service.

“I’m proud to launch Valletta FC’s new mobile service which is surely a first for Maltese football,” president Victor Sciriha said at the launch of VFC Mobile yesterday.

Describing the mobile service venture as “another important chapter in the history of the club”, Sciriha said Valletta, who have chosen YOM Limited as their technical partners, will be making use of Vodafone’s “reliable” infrastructure.

“Potential VFC Mobile subscribers can retain their current mobile number or apply for a new one,” Sciriha said.

“Our tariffs are among the most competitive in the local market. Furthermore, we have plans to hold a competition among VFC subscribers and the winner will be given the chance to travel with the team for a European match next summer.”

Sciriha stressed that Valletta are committed to offering their VFC subscribers a good service. “A year ago we announced our intention to operate a mobile phone service,” Sciriha said. “It has taken us so long to launch it because we wanted to make sure that we could offer an efficient service. Now it’s the time to implement those plans.

“On Wednesday, I and my fellow committee members will be at the club from 10 a.m. onwards to receive applications for VFC Mobile. I hope that this initiative will be a success for the club and for Maltese football in general. I’ve always felt that the only club who could embark on a project of this magnitude is Valletta FC as our numerous fans are the most fervent in Malta.”

Valletta have set themselves an initial target of 1,000 subscribers over the next few months. Another ‘open day’ at the Valletta FC club is also planned for December 13.

VFC Mobile SIM cards and top-up vouchers can be purchased from several outlets, including Tip Top, L-Amerikan and Brown’s Pharamacies.

Malcolm Mallia, director of YOM Limited, said: “We are proud to be associated with Valletta, a club with a rich history in Maltese football.

“Valletta are willing to penetrate a new market which was previously the domain of big companies like Vodafone and Go. Our intention is certainly not to compete with them but Valletta FC are keen to offer a more focused service to their customers.”
